preloader
Lydra charge...

Pourquoi l’approche GitOps devrait être le flux de travail de prédilection

Qu’est ce que le GitOps et comment l’appliquer dans un environnement réel ?   Comment en sommes-nous arrivés là ? En 2006, avec le lancement du service AWS Elastic Compute, Amazon a déclenché une révolution dans la manière dont nous, en tant que développeurs, consommons et utilisons les ressources informatiques nécessaire pour déployer et maintenir les applications que nous écrivons. Très peu de temps après, l’infrastructure-as-code a commencée à exploser avec des

👨‍💻 Live Coding | Bash | My GitLab Runner | 5. Chargement du fichier de configuration

Je m'essaie au code en « live » sur un petit projet #Bash Libre : lancer un runner dans un dépôt de code.     Tu cherches une instance GitLab hébergée en France ? Rejoins la bêta de #Froggit   Comment est-ce que l'on va charger le fichier de configuration ? Quelles méthodes as-t-on à disposition en Bash ?   00:00 Intro 00:18 Je nettoie mon dépôt avant de commencer 01:08 Je

Accélérer vos pipelines d’Intégration Continue grâce au graphe orienté acyclique (DAG)

Un graphe orienté acyclique permet d’exécuter les différentes étapes du pipeline dans le désordre, faisant fi du séquençage des étapes et permettant relier les tâches entre elles directement.   Récemment, GitLab a lancé une fonctionnalité exceptionnelle qui permet de réduire le temps d’exécution du pipeline et qui offre un gain de flexibilité dans l’ordre d’exécution des tâches. Cette fonctionnalité : le graphe orienté acyclique (DAG : Directed Acyclic Graph) est maintenant disponible

👨‍💻 Live Coding | Bash | My GitLab Runner | 4. Les bonnes pratiques

Je m'essaie au code en « live » sur un petit projet #Bash Libre : lancer un runner dans un dépôt de code.   Tu cherches une instance GitLab hébergée en France ? Rejoins la bêta de #Froggit   Aujourd'hui on parle des bonnes pratiques et du style de codage. Dites moi en commentaire si des vidéos sur les test en Bash vous intéressent. 00:00 Intro 00:18 Je démarre toujours avec un

L’intégration continue GitLab-CI pour les débutants

Voici comment aider tous les membres de votre équipe, designers, testeurs ou autres, à démarrer avec GitLab CI.   Chez fleetster, ils ont leur propre instance de GitLab et ils s’appuient beaucoup sur GitLab CI/CD. Leurs designers et leurs responsables qualité l'utilisent (et l'adorent) en raison de ses fonctionnalités avancées. GitLab CI/CD est un système très puissant d'intégration continue, doté de nombreuses fonctionnalités différentes, de plus en plus avancées à

👨‍💻 Live Coding | Bash | My GitLab Runner | 3. Initialisation du Script et configuration de VSCode ( VSCodium)

Je m'essaie au code en « live » sur un petit projet #Bash Libre : lancer un runner dans un dépôt de code. 00:00 Intro 00:50 Ajout d'un badge de pipeline gitlab-ci 03:09 Initialisation du script bash 05:58 ShellSheck dans VSCodium 13:12 Lancement de ShellSheck en ligne de commande 15:31 Clôture   Tu cherches une instance GitLab hébergée en France ? Rejoins la bêta de Froggit.   Les liens : Le dépôt git

Débloquez un meilleur DevOps avec GitLab CI/CD

Pourquoi une application unique permet d’éliminer les silos et les lacunes en matière de connaissances. GitLab a déjà parlé de la façon dont la collaboration harmonieuse entre les équipes de développement et infrastructure est une belle chose. Lorsqu'une organisation a une culture DevOps saine, elle est en mesure d’atteindre ses objectifs commerciaux et d’augmenter la vitesse de livraison. Le DevOps est destiné à éliminer les cloisonnements afin que tout le

🧭 Découverte | 🐸 La bêta de Froggit

Que ce passe-t-il quand on s'inscrit à la bêta #Froggit ? 00:00 D'où vient l'idée de Froggit ? 02:54 Comment se passe l'inscription? 03:32 Les fonctionnalités de Froggit 04:06 Je m'inscris 05:40 On sonde les besoins utilisateurs 08:11 Première connexion au Lab : l'usine logicielle 09:57 J'ai reçu un mail de Kermit 🥰 11:41 Le chat de Froggit et son SSO 16:15 Clôture   Tu cherches une instance GitLab hébergée

7 raisons pour passer à l’intégration continue

Découvrez les 7 raisons pour lesquelles vous et votre entreprise devriez utiliser l’intégration continue pour des résultats exceptionnels   Lorsque vous développez un logiciel, vous êtes généralement face à un dilemme de taille. Vous avez le choix parmi de nombreux langages de programmation, différentes suites de tests à essayer, un nombre infini de frameworks que vous pouvez utiliser et de nombreuses offres d’intégration continue. Il vous est toujours possible de

💻 Live Coding | Bash | My GitLab Runner | 2. Gitlab-CI et ShellCheck

Je m'essaie au code en « live » sur un petit projet #Bash Libre : lancer un GitLab runneur dans un dépôt de code.     00:00 Intro 00:15 Buts de la session 01:04 Initialisation de la CI & le projet Libre gitlab-ci-templates 04:09 ShellCheck : un bash lint 06:38 La première pipeline 08:55 On peu fusionner 09:25 On rebase une branche en retard sur master 11:48 Clôture   Tu cherches une